Restaurant Summary

The room feels warm and bustling as waves lap just beyond the patio rail. Servers are often named and celebrated in reviews, and one guest wrote their evening felt effortlessly taken care of. Snag a sunset seat and you get the full oceanfront spectacle. The cooking leans elevated seafood with global accents rather than theatrics: mahi mahi dore with preserved lemon, scallops with shiitake beurre blanc, and a decadent crab mac that regulars crave. Cocktails and mocktails show care, so this fits diners who enjoy polished classics in a destination setting. Families do fine here thanks to friendly service and approachable dishes like pizza, burgers, and fries alongside seafood. There is no explicit kids menu noted, but staff have welcomed toddlers and celebrations. Expect adult pricing; pick simpler items if your crew is picky with flavors.

Lahaina TownLahaina Town offers a lively dining scene with a mix of casual eateries, seafood restaurants, and upscale dining options. The atmosphere is relaxed yet bustling, reflecting its status as a key tourist destination with a strong local community presence.
Front StreetFront Street is the main commercial strip in Lahaina, known for its shops, galleries, and waterfront dining. It is a vibrant area with a strong focus on tourism, offering a variety of dining options from casual to fine dining, often with ocean views and a lively social atmosphere.
